The staff of the department are continuing and developing the traditions and scientific schools of Adjunct Professor I.I. Khalfin, prof. M.G. Kurbangaleev, E.M. Akhunzyanov, F.S. Safiullina, R.R. Zamaletdinov in the field of general and comparative typological linguistics, Turkic and Tatar linguistics (synchrony and diachrony), the methodology of teaching Tatar language for a foreign language audience, translation studies, lexicography, linguoculturology and intercultural communication. They conduct active scientific and educational activities in the area of general and Turkic linguistics.

The goal of the department is the preparation of highly qualified, competitive philologists, strengthening the leading position of the department as a leading scientific and educational center in the field of general linguistics and Turkic studies.

The Department of General Linguistics and Turkology offers the following educational programs:

- Philology: Applied Philology: Tatar language and literature, theory of translation with advanced study of foreign language (bachelor's degree);

- Philology: Applied Philology: Tatar language and literature, journalism

- Master's degree in Philology ("Philology, Türkic Languages in Intercultural Communication") (45.04.01), ("Philology, Turkology") (45.04.01), ("Tataristics") (45.04.01).

Department includes:

- Postgraduate and doctoral studies in the field of "Russian Language" (10.02.01), "Comparative-historical, Typological and Contrastive linguistics " (10.02.20);

- Postgraduate studies in the field of "Languages of the Russian Federation peoples" (10.02.02), "Theory of language" (10.02.19);
